Manor Mill

A restored, pre-revolutionary grist mill that now houses a fine arts gallery, musical performances, ceramics, yoga and meditation, workshops across all disciplines and organizational retreats. Manor Mill is a community built upon creativity and learning.

Kas Rohm

Kas Rohm

Represented ArtistInstructor Watercolor
Instagram
Watercolor Artist Kas Rohm enjoys creative realism in her watercolors, often with the use of waterproof ink to bring out the details. Living most of her life not far from the Manor Mill Gallery, Kas finds inspiration from the local community and environment, often infusing a splash of whimsy into her paintings and illustrations.
